What Is the Difference of the between Steam Distillation and Co2 Extract?

For the essential oil , In steam distillation, the molecular composition of both the plant matter and the essential oil are may changed due to the temperature applied. On the other hand, a CO2 extract is closer in chemical composition to the original plant from which it is derived, as it contains a wider range of the plant's constituents.

What Is Co2 Extraction Of Essential Oils?

A

Essential oils by CO2 extraction is a process that uses pressurized carbon dioxide to pull the desired phytochemicals from a plant.

Carbon dioxide (CO2) extraction is a modern technique for collecting essential oils by using CO2 as a solvent. Although the equipment needed for this method is costly, the overall process is fast and efficient compared to steam distillation while producing comparatively high quality yields.
